The plant is of the determinate type, compact, of medium vigor, reaching a height of 60–90 cm. The ripening period is 55–60 days from the moment of seedling transplanting. The hybrid is recommended for planting with a density of 22–27 thousand plants per hectare.
The fruits are round or oblate in shape, deep red in color, weighing 80–160 g. They are characterized by firmness, the absence of a green spot at the peduncle, and resistance to cracking, which ensures good transportability.
The hybrid possesses high resistance to tobacco mosaic virus, tomato mosaic virus, Fusarium wilt, Verticillium wilt, Stemphylium, and tomato spotted wilt virus. Moderate resistance to late blight is also noted.
